Blue Mountain is a pet friendly park, there are three very friendly dogs on-site that are unleashed. They are friendly with people of all ages and they also enjoy meeting other dogs. Their names are Duke, Mia and Bruno.

Guests are welcome to bring their pets, we just request that pet owners ensure their pet is housetrained prior to bringing them inside cabins, and be sure to clean up any mess they make. We do not charge a pet fee, however, if there are any damages done to the cabin during your stay damage fees will be applied. Damage fees will vary depending on the nature of the damage.

For day visits with your pet, we ask to ensure your dog is well trained prior to being off-leash within the park. 

Dogs are welcome on the trails year round.
